Knee/Hamstring/Tendonitis/Back? What is the problem?

I’ve been down about 11 months now and don’t know what to do next.
I was finishing up a 22 mile run last December when my left leg started hurting and would not respond. I stretched it out and finished up the last half mile. I was moving way to fast on this run, under 7 minute miles.

The next day, my leg would not bend all of the way out. The pain seemed to be coming out of the back of the knee/very low hamstring. Sort of like a pulling right in the bend of the knee.
I really messed up after this running a marathon and a few months later doing some track racing (800m-3200m).

Over time the pain seemed to be much more of a hamstring pain. I did about 2, 6 week physical therapy sessions, with no progress.

I looked into the possibility of a back/nerve problem, and discovered I did have some developing back problems, but most likely not enough to be causing my problems. The doctor said it could be irritating the nerve some, but not pinching it or anything.

Now it has gone back very low in the hamstring, and sometimes feels like strings pulling in the back of the knee.

Does the idea of strings pulling in the back of the knee tell anyone anything? Has anyone else had anything like this?

Most importantly is there anything else I can do? Is there any thing I can ask a doctor do do to find out once and for all where the problem is? I’m sick of them guessing this or that, every doctor has had a different diagnosis.
